What companies run services between Stroud, England and Swansea, Wales?

You can take a train from Stroud (Glos) to Swansea via Gloucester and Newport (S Wales) in around 2h 56m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Merrywalks to Swansea Bus Station Stand B via Transport Hub and Bus Station in around 5h 44m.
